For additional interfaces to operate, you must configure the FireboxV or XTMv virtual machine in the vSphere Web Client to add the number of network adapters you want to enable in the FireboxV device configuration. Do not use a e1000 virtual network adapter.Īfter you create the FireboxV or XTMv virtual machine, you can enable and configure additional network interfaces. When you create the FireboxV or XTMv virtual machine in the ESXi environment, before you run the Fireware Web Setup Wizard, you must map each of these interfaces to a destination network.įor the best network performance and stability, we recommend that you choose a vmxnet3 virtual network adapter for each Firebox interface. The trusted interface, Interface 1, has a default IP address of 10.0.1.1. To connect to this interface for the initial device configuration, you must map this interface to a destination network that has a DHCP server. The external interface, Interface 0, is set up by default to request an IP address from a DHCP server. When you create a FireboxV or XTMv virtual appliance, it is initially configured with two active interfaces.
